Thunder still need to make a decision on Abdel Nader

One of the few contracts the Oklahoma City Thunder front office members knew they needed to address entering the 2019 offseason was Abdel Nader’s. Of course, a few other players of greater importance to the franchise’s future unexpectedly changed the course of the team’s direction, leaving Sam Presti and company a few other things to address before looking to Nader.

Monday is the deadline for the Thunder to pick up the wing’s contract for 2019-20. If he stays on the roster, Nader is guaranteed a little over $1.6 million. However, cutting Nader would assist the Thunder in their continued pursuit of getting below the luxury tax bill. Waiving him would put them $2.6 million over the line.

But with Nader’s deal being so cost-effective, it makes more sense for Oklahoma City to retain the forward while Sam Presti works to move some of the team’s larger contracts and possibly accrue even more future draft picks.
